WebLiddell & Scott's Greek-English Lexicon (9/e 1940) is the most comprehensive and up-to-date ancient Greek dictionary in the world. It is used by every student of ancient Greek in the English-speaking world, and is an essential library and scholarly purchase there and in W. Europe and Japan. WebIn 1806 Webster published A Compendious Dictionary of the English Language, the first truly American dictionary.
